US state where I had a house (5)

Ross

I believe the answer is:

idaho

'us state' is the definition.
(I've seen this before)

'i had a house' is the wordplay.
'i had' becomes 'id' (I'd).
'house' becomes 'ho' (abbreviation for house).
'id'+'a'+'ho'='IDAHO'

'where' is the link.
